DVD/Nav Switch for Don's TVandNav2go

I did a search for a DVD/Nav Switch for Don's TVandNav2go. I found the thread for the factory switch the has ben modified but is sounds like it is no longer being made.

Has anybody come up with a good solution? If so, let me know I would like to see it.

the switch list from acura is about $9. push on and off from radio shack is $3. super easy to make, takes about 10 mins, minus sanding and paint. another member airbrushed using testors flat black, i got ghetto and used a can of auto primer i already had. sand off the paint on the switch itself, get a sticker made (or do what i did, i printed to PS logo from the net, taped it to a sticker i had laying around and cut it with an xacto knife) pm me if you have any questions
